/*
https://lingtalfi.com/bootstrap4-color-generator
*/
/*------------------------------------
- COLOR dark
------------------------------------*/
.alert-dark {
    color: #000000;
    background-color: #929c94;
    border-color: #879389;
}

.alert-dark hr {
    border-top-color: #7a867c;
}

.alert-dark .alert-link {
    color: #000000;
}

.badge-dark {
    color: #fff;
    background-color: #2f3430;
}

.badge-dark[href]:hover, .badge-dark[href]:focus {
    color: #fff;
    background-color: #161917;
}

.bg-dark {
    background-color: #2f3430 !important;
}

a.bg-dark:hover, a.bg-dark:focus,
button.bg-dark:hover,
button.bg-dark:focus {
    background-color: #161917 !important;
}

.border-dark {
    border-color: #2f3430 !important;
}

.btn-dark {
    color: #fff;
    background-color: #2f3430;
    border-color: #2f3430;
}

.btn-dark:hover {
    color: #fff;
    background-color: #1e211e;
    border-color: #161917;
}

.btn-dark:focus, .btn-dark.focus {
    box-shadow: 0 0 0 0.2rem rgba(47, 52, 48, 0.5);
}

.btn-dark.disabled, .btn-dark:disabled {
    color: #fff;
    background-color: #2f3430;
    border-color: #2f3430;
}

.btn-dark:not(:disabled):not(.disabled):active, .btn-dark:not(:disabled):not(.disabled).active, .show > .btn-dark.dropdown-toggle {
    color: #fff;
    background-color: #161917;
    border-color: #0f110f;
}

.btn-dark:not(:disabled):not(.disabled):active:focus, .btn-dark:not(:disabled):not(.disabled).active:focus, .show > .btn-dark.dropdown-toggle:focus {
    box-shadow: 0 0 0 0.2rem rgba(47, 52, 48, 0.5);
}

.btn-outline-dark {
    color: #2f3430;
    background-color: transparent;
    border-color: #2f3430;
}

.btn-outline-dark:hover {
    color: #fff;
    background-color: #2f3430;
    border-color: #2f3430;
}

.btn-outline-dark:focus, .btn-outline-dark.focus {
    box-shadow: 0 0 0 0.2rem rgba(47, 52, 48, 0.5);
}

.btn-outline-dark.disabled, .btn-outline-dark:disabled {
    color: #2f3430;
    background-color: transparent;
}

.btn-outline-dark:not(:disabled):not(.disabled):active, .btn-outline-dark:not(:disabled):not(.disabled).active, .show > .btn-outline-dark.dropdown-toggle {
    color: #fff;
    background-color: #2f3430;
    border-color: #2f3430;
}

.btn-outline-dark:not(:disabled):not(.disabled):active:focus, .btn-outline-dark:not(:disabled):not(.disabled).active:focus, .show > .btn-outline-dark.dropdown-toggle:focus {
    box-shadow: 0 0 0 0.2rem rgba(47, 52, 48, 0.5);
}

.list-group-item-dark {
    color: #000000;
    background-color: #879389;
}

.list-group-item-dark.list-group-item-action:hover, .list-group-item-dark.list-group-item-action:focus {
    color: #000000;
    background-color: #7a867c;
}

.list-group-item-dark.list-group-item-action.active {
    color: #fff;
    background-color: #000000;
    border-color: #000000;
}

.table-dark,
.table-dark > th,
.table-dark > td {
    background-color: #879389;
}

.table-hover .table-dark:hover {
    background-color: #7a867c;
}

.table-hover .table-dark:hover > td,
.table-hover .table-dark:hover > th {
    background-color: #7a867c;
}

.text-dark {
    color: #2f3430 !important;
}

a.text-dark:hover, a.text-dark:focus {
    color: #161917 !important;
}



/*------------------------------------
- COLOR primary
------------------------------------*/
.alert-primary {
    color: #006cd9;
    background-color: #121110ff;
    border-color: #10c105ff;
}

.alert-primary hr {
    border-top-color: #f3f9ff;
}

.alert-primary .alert-link {
    color: #0053a6;
}

.badge-primary {
    color: #212529;
    background-color: #55aaff;
}

.badge-primary[href]:hover, .badge-primary[href]:focus {
    color: #212529;
    background-color: #2190ff;
}

.bg-primary {
    background-color: #55aaff !important;
}

a.bg-primary:hover, a.bg-primary:focus,
button.bg-primary:hover,
button.bg-primary:focus {
    background-color: #2190ff !important;
}

.border-primary {
    border-color: #55aaff !important;
}

.btn-primary {
    /* color: #212529; */
    background-color: #55aaff;
    border-color: #55aaff;
}

.btn-primary:hover {
    /* color: #212529; */
    background-color: #3198ff;
    border-color: #2190ff;
}

.btn-primary:focus, .btn-primary.focus {
    box-shadow: 0 0 0 0.2rem rgba(85, 170, 255, 0.5);
}

.btn-primary.disabled, .btn-primary:disabled {
    color: #212529;
    background-color: #55aaff;
    border-color: #55aaff;
}

.btn-primary:not(:disabled):not(.disabled):active, .btn-primary:not(:disabled):not(.disabled).active, .show > .btn-primary.dropdown-toggle {
    color: #212529;
    background-color: #2190ff;
    border-color: #1288ff;
}

.btn-primary:not(:disabled):not(.disabled):active:focus, .btn-primary:not(:disabled):not(.disabled).active:focus, .show > .btn-primary.dropdown-toggle:focus {
    box-shadow: 0 0 0 0.2rem rgba(85, 170, 255, 0.5);
}

.btn-outline-primary {
    color: #55aaff;
    background-color: transparent;
    border-color: #55aaff;
}

.btn-outline-primary:hover {
    color: #212529;
    background-color: #55aaff;
    border-color: #55aaff;
}

.btn-outline-primary:focus, .btn-outline-primary.focus {
    box-shadow: 0 0 0 0.2rem rgba(85, 170, 255, 0.5);
}

.btn-outline-primary.disabled, .btn-outline-primary:disabled {
    color: #55aaff;
    background-color: transparent;
}

.btn-outline-primary:not(:disabled):not(.disabled):active, .btn-outline-primary:not(:disabled):not(.disabled).active, .show > .btn-outline-primary.dropdown-toggle {
    color: #212529;
    background-color: #55aaff;
    border-color: #55aaff;
}

.btn-outline-primary:not(:disabled):not(.disabled):active:focus, .btn-outline-primary:not(:disabled):not(.disabled).active:focus, .show > .btn-outline-primary.dropdown-toggle:focus {
    box-shadow: 0 0 0 0.2rem rgba(85, 170, 255, 0.5);
}

.list-group-item-primary {
    color: #006cd9;
    background-color: #10c105ff;
}

.list-group-item-primary.list-group-item-action:hover, .list-group-item-primary.list-group-item-action:focus {
    color: #006cd9;
    background-color: #f3f9ff;
}

.list-group-item-primary.list-group-item-action.active {
    color: #212529;
    background-color: #006cd9;
    border-color: #006cd9;
}

.table-primary,
.table-primary > th,
.table-primary > td {
    background-color: #10c105ff;
}

.table-hover .table-primary:hover {
    background-color: #f3f9ff;
}

.table-hover .table-primary:hover > td,
.table-hover .table-primary:hover > th {
    background-color: #f3f9ff;
}

.text-primary {
    color: #55aaff !important;
}

a.text-primary:hover, a.text-primary:focus {
    color: #2190ff !important;
}
